Shikalo▶ 給付で試算
ホームアセンブリ言語 > 教材

「コンピュータの仕組み」(朝倉書店)の評判・価格・レビュー

アセンブリ言語を学ぶための教材の基本情報・価格・レビュー。

PR・広告を含みます
コンピュータの仕組みの表紙
著者
尾内 理紀夫 / 朝倉書店
価格
3740円 (楽天ブックス)
発売日
2003年03月28日頃
楽天レビュー
楽天ブックスで見る ›Amazonで見る ›

アセンブリ言語をスクールで学ぶなら、教育訓練給付で最大80%OFF

対象講座なら受講料の最大80%(給付区分・上限・要件あり)が後日戻り、実質負担を抑えられます。独学の本+スクールの併用も。
▶ あなたの講座でいくら戻るか試算(無料・30秒)

スクール教育訓練給付 最大80%
SHIFT TERAS CAMPUS東証上場SHIFTが運営
旧DMM WEBCAMP・教育訓練給付 最大80%対象
受講料 910,800円 → 給付後 約270,800円
✓ 条件を満たせば受講料全額返金の転職保証コースあり(規定あり)
無料相談で適用条件を確認できます
無料で詳細・相談 ›評判・給付の詳しい解説 ›
PR
スクール教育訓練給付 最大80%
ディープロ(DPro)
未経験→Webエンジニア・専門実践給付80%対象
受講料 797,800円 → 給付後 約344,340円
✓ 規定の就職サポート後に内定なしなら受講料全額返金(規定あり)
無料相談で適用条件を確認できます
無料で詳細・相談 ›評判・給付の詳しい解説 ›
PR
スクールリスキリング 最大70%
ポテパンキャンプ
Webエンジニア養成・経産省リスキリング最大70%
受講料 440,000円 → 給付後 実質 約160,000円〜
✓ 規定の就活で内定なしなら受講料全額返金(条件あり)
無料相談で適用条件を確認できます
無料で詳細・相談 ›評判・給付の詳しい解説 ›
PR

はじめての方へ:教育訓練給付のしくみと損しない選び方 / 申請手順5ステップ

学習・開発環境
ロリポップ!レンタルサーバー
最安級で始めるサイト・ブログ公開環境。60秒でWordPress導入。
エコノミー121円/月〜・ハイスピード660円/月〜
公式で詳細 ›
PR

学んだ後に「作って公開する」ための環境例です。サーバー・ツールは教育訓練給付/補助の対象外です。

※給付率・実質額は区分(一般20%/特定一般40%/専門実践 最大80%)と要件で変わり、即時値引きでなく後日支給です。最終可否はハローワーク・厚労省でご確認ください。掲載はPR(送客手数料を受領)。

この本について

計算機の中身・仕組の基本を「本当に大切なところ」をおさえながら重点主義的に懇切丁寧に解説〔内容〕概論/数の表現/オペランドとアドレス/基本的演算と操作/MIPSアセンブリ言語と機械語/パイプライン処理/記憶階層/入出力/他 1. ノイマン型コンピュータ 1.1 開発略史 1.2 定義 1.3 構造と機能 1.4 マイクロプロセッサ 1.5 性能比較 2. アーキテクチャとハードウェア,ソフトウェア 2.1 アーキテクチャ 2.2 ハードウェア階層とソフトウェア階層 2.3 翻訳階層 3. 数の表現 3.1 ビットの意味 3.2 基数 3.3 N進数からM進数への変換 3.4 整数 3.5 実数 4. オペランドとアドレス 4.1 オペランド形式 4.2 オペランド指定とアーキテクチャ 4.3 アドレス指定 4.4 アドレス付与規則 5. 基本的演算とその拡張 5.1 論理演算 5.2 加算と減算 5.3 乗算 5.4 除算 5.5 シフト演算 5.6 サブルーチン 6. MIPSアセンブリ言語と機械語 6.1 アセンブリ言語構文 6.2 機械語命令の形式 6.3 命令詳細 7. パイプライン処理 7.1 たとえ話 7.2 RISC型CPU 7.3 流れを乱すもの 8. 記憶階層 8.1 局所性原理と階層構造 8.2 キャッシュ方式 8.3 仮想記憶方式 9. 入出力 9.1 入出カインタフェース 9.2 入出力制御 付録A. EDSACのプログラミング A.1 プログラム可変法 A.2 Bレジスタ法 A.3 サブルーチン 付録B. MIPSシミュレータ:SPIM B.1 GUI B.2 アセンブラ指令 B.3 システムコール B.4 プログラム例 B.5 機械語命令のビット列 付録C. MIPS合成命令 C.1 乗算合成命令 C.2 除算合成命令 C.3 比較合成命令 C.4 分岐合成命令 付録D. SPARCアセンプリ言語と機械語 D.1 アセンブリ言語構文 D.2 機械語命令の形式 D.3 命令詳細 参考文献 索 引

判型:全集・双書/シリーズ:情報科学こんせぷつ 1

アセンブリ言語とは

「アセンブリ言語」は、CPU が直接扱う命令列を記述する低水準言語で、機械語と高級言語の中間的な表現です。メモリ、レジスタ、フラグの状態を意識して書くため、内部動作の理解が深まりやすくなります。

こんな人向け:ハードウェア寄りの処理に興味がある人向けです。CやPythonなどで基本的なプログラミング経験があり、整数表現や配列といった基礎を知っていると進みやすいです。

独学ロードマップでの位置

学習順では、まずCPUの基本モデルを押さえた後に命令体系へ進むと理解しやすくなります。アセンブリは高級言語を裏側から支える知識として、デバッグ力や性能理解の土台を作る位置づけです。

  1. 2進数・16進数、アドレス、エンディアンなど数表現の基礎を復習する。
  2. 対象アーキテクチャのレジスタ、命令形式、データサイズを整理する。
  3. 加算・分岐・繰り返しなど簡単な命令を実行し、各命令後の状態を追跡する。
  4. スタックや呼び出し規約を扱い、関数処理の流れを図で確認する。
  5. OSやリンカの説明とつなげて、同じ操作がどこで変換されるかを確認する。

独学で足りる?体系的に学ぶ選択肢

独学の要点は、暗記よりも「1行ごとの意味を説明できる」ことです。解説付きで実行できる例題が豊富な教材、特にエラー時の原因追跡が丁寧に示される構成を選ぶと継続しやすくなります。

期限がある人や独学が不安な人には、進行が明確な体系的な学びの流れが向きます。演習・確認問題・フィードバックが一体になった枠組みなら、理解の空白を早めに埋めやすくなります。 ▶ 給付でいくら戻るか試算

よくある質問

Q. アセンブリはどの人が学ぶ価値がありますか?

低レベルな挙動に関心がある人、既存コードの性能やバグ原因を深く追いたい人に有効です。すぐ実務で使うかどうかより、基礎理解として持つと設計判断の幅が広がります。

Q. 難しさが大きいイメージですが、初学者でも進められますか?

慣れが必要な分野で、初期はつまずきやすいです。1つの命令がどの資源を変えるかを小さな例で確認する学習なら、着実に理解を積み上げられます。

Q. 何から始めると詰まりにくいですか?

数表現やメモリの基礎から入り、次に命令セットとレジスタを学びます。途中で大きなテーマに飛ばさず、実行→観察→修正の反復を短いサイクルで回すのが定着しやすいです。

次の一冊:次はCPUアーキテクチャ全般、OS入門、低レベルC言語の読解へ進むと、アセンブリの役割がさらに明確になります。実際のソフトウェア設計との接続として、コンピュータ構成の基礎も合わせて読むと効果的です。

アセンブリ言語の関連教材

プログラムの絵本 プログラミングの基本がわかる9つの扉の表紙
プログラムの絵本 プログラミングの基本がわかる9つの扉
1958円
やさしいアセンブラ入門の表紙
やさしいアセンブラ入門
2750円
ARMで学ぶアセンブリ言語入門の表紙
ARMで学ぶアセンブリ言語入門
3520円
計算システム入門の表紙
計算システム入門
3740円
Z-80/8085対応 マイコン応用システムの基礎の表紙
Z-80/8085対応 マイコン応用システムの基礎
3190円
アセンブリ言語の基礎の表紙
アセンブリ言語の基礎
3080円

アセンブリ言語の教材をもっと見る ›

給付対応スクール給付でいくら戻る?試算